Collaboration in amaise offers you two ways to work with others:
Direct request (chat) — Ask a colleague or an external person a quick question via chat. (See "Collaboration: Ask a colleague or external person")
Formal request to external service providers — Send a structured request to an external service provider. (This article)
For more complex questions, you can send a formal request to an external service provider (e.g., an expert office). These requests follow a structured process with assignment, response, and review.
Create a new formal request
Open a case and click the Collaboration icon in the tool bar on the right edge of the screen
Click "New request"
Pick the external service provider as the recipient (see the next section) — the request is then automatically formal
Note: You only see a type choice when you pick a direct colleague — that makes the request a chat. With external service providers there is nothing to choose: formal is the only way.
Select recipient
Choose the external service provider to whom the request should be addressed. You will find the available providers in the "External service providers" section of the recipient list.
Formulate the request
Enter a subject — summarize your request in a few words, as it is also used as the subject for emails
Write your question in the text field
Choose the priority: "Normal" or "Urgent"
Optional: "Attach files" — add additional files (PDF, Word, Excel, or ZIP)
💡 If the external service provider does not yet have valid access to the case, you have to grant access first — directly in the request form. (See "Collaboration: Access Management")
Submit the request
Click "Create". The request will be sent to the external service provider.
Mark request as urgent
You can mark an already submitted request as urgent via its three-dot menu. The recipient will then see that your request has priority.
Additionally, the subject line of the notification emails receives the [Urgent] tag (in the recipient's language). This tag appears only in the email — in the app, the request shows the "Urgent" priority.
The formal process
A formal request goes through the following steps:
"Draft" → You create the request
"Unassigned" → The administrator at the external service provider assigns the request to an expert
"In progress" → The expert works on the response
"Response under review" → The administrator reviews the response
"Completed" → You receive and can view the response
Cancel request
If you want to withdraw a request, click the three-dot menu next to the request and select "Cancel request". The request will be withdrawn and the external service provider notified accordingly.
View response
💡 You will automatically receive an email notification as soon as the request is completed and answered.
Once the request is completed, you will see:
The expert's response — as text and/or attached files
The "Request history" — all steps and status changes
Close request
When you are satisfied with the response, you can archive the request via "Archive request".
